Live game definition

Live game means a gambling game which does not involve an electronic gaming device and which is played with a live gaming device.
Live game means a table game that is played at a gaming table operated by employees of the licensed limited gaming facility who are physically present at the table during all table game play.
Live game means, without limitation, roulette; a game of cards (including also such games organized as tournaments); and, a game of dice.

More Definitions of Live game

Live game means any game in which the dealer participates together with the player, or several players are given an opportunity to participate simultaneously without the participation of the dealer (except for automatic games);
Live game means a game conducted by a gaming attendant (e.g., dealer, croupier, etc.) or other gaming equipment (e.g., an automated roulette wheel, ball blower, or gaming device), or both, in a live game environment in which authorized participants have the ability to review game play and communicate game decisions through the internet gaming platform. Live games include, but are not limited to, live card games, live table games, and live play of gaming devices, and other live authorized games.
Live game means a game played between persons or between persons and a gaming employee on the premises of a licensed gambling operator.
